For the complete documentation index, see llms.txt. This page is also available as Markdown.

Test adding product coupons to the InLine Checkout

Overview

Use the TwoCoInlineCart.card.addCoupons(['COUPON']) method to apply multiple coupons.

Use case - add coupons

  1. Add an HTML link or button in your page like the one below.

  2. Create a JavaScript click handler to execute the Inline Client desired methods.

  3. Use the TwoCoInlineCart.products.add({code, quantity, options})method to prepare your catalog product.

  4. To apply several coupons to your cart products, use theTwoCoInlineCart.card.addCoupons(['COUPON'])method.

  5. To show the cart on your page call theTwoCoInlineCart.cart.checkout()method.

Sample request

HTML

<a href="#" class="btn btn-success" id="buy-button">Buy now!</a>

JavaScript

window.document.getElementById('buy-button').addEventListener('click', function() {
  TwoCoInlineCart.products.add({
    code: "74B8E17CC0"
  });
  TwoCoInlineCart.cart.addCoupons(['CUPON']);
  TwoCoInlineCart.cart.checkout();
});

Demo

After setting the test mode to add coupons to the InLine Checkout using the above method, your cart should look like this:

Last updated

Was this helpful?